Abstract :
There is an increasing need for various Web-service, e-commerce and e-business sites to provide personalized recommendations to on-line customers. This paper proposes a new type of personalized recommendation agents called fuzzy cognitive agents. Fuzzy cognitive agents are designed to give personalized suggestions based on the user´s current personal preferences, other user´s common preferences, and an expert´s domain knowledge. Fuzzy cognitive agents are able to represent knowledge via extended fuzzy cognitive maps, learn users´ preferences from most recent cases, and help customers make inferences and decisions through numeric computation instead of symbolic and logic deduction. A case study is included to illustrate how personalized recommendations are made by fuzzy cognitive agents in e-commerce sites. The case study demonstrates that the fuzzy cognitive agent is both flexible and effective in supporting e-commerce applications.
